I think another thing to consider is having ways for people to reach you _without_ your cell phone. For instance, I have a home phone, and calling my cell also rings that home phone. You could set up something similar if you have an office phone, or using a softphone on your desktop. That leaves you with instances where you leave home or the office, which are honestly cases where I'm personally least likely to look at my phone because I'm usually doing things that occupy my full attention (unless I'm commuting where I'm often reading a book on my phone).
